Hi All, Need some ideas on charging nicads to get the most life out of them in low duty cycle pulsed current load and as long life as possible Situation is similar to a smoke alarm. Any ideas ? The product will have an AVR something like a Tiny15, but I do not want to go to the extreams of the AVR app note 450 design, the device will be selfcontained running off the 240Vac using more than likely a mains voltage reg or capacitive divider to ~12 then zener resistive to +5v for the AVR.
